Understanding Each Size
Let’s break down each size to understand what you can expect:
- Short: The smallest size on the Starbucks menu, the Short is 8 ounces. It’s perfect for those who want a strong, rich coffee without too much volume. This size is ideal for espresso-based drinks, as it allows the full flavor of the espresso to shine through.
- Tall: The Tall size is 12 ounces, making it a popular choice for many Starbucks customers. It offers a good balance between flavor and volume, suitable for both hot and cold beverages.
- Grande: At 16 ounces, the Grande is the medium size at Starbucks and is also the default size for many drinks. It’s a versatile size that works well for a wide range of beverages, from lattes to refreshers.
- Venti: The largest size on the menu, the Venti comes in two volumes: 20 ounces for hot beverages and 24 ounces for cold beverages. It’s designed for those who want a larger drink or need an extra caffeine boost to get through their day.

What are the different coffee sizes offered by Starbucks?
Starbucks offers a variety of coffee sizes to cater to different customer preferences. The sizes include Short, Tall, Grande, and Venti for hot beverages, and Tall, Grande, and Venti for cold beverages. The Short size is the smallest, equivalent to 8 ounces, while the Venti size is the largest, equivalent to 20 ounces for hot beverages and 24 ounces for cold beverages. Can I get a refill on my Starbucks coffee, and does the size affect the refill policy?
Starbucks offers free refills on brewed coffee and tea for customers who are members of the Starbucks Rewards program. However, the size of the coffee does not affect the refill policy. Customers can get a refill on any size coffee, from Short to Venti, as long as they are a member of the rewards program and have purchased a brewed coffee or tea. The refill policy is designed to provide customers with a convenient and affordable way to enjoy their favorite Starbucks drinks, and the company encourages customers to take advantage of this benefit.
It’s worth noting that the refill policy only applies to brewed coffee and tea, and not to espresso-based drinks or other beverages. Additionally, customers must present their rewards card or mobile app to receive a refill.
